changeset 18606:fe1cdc40579c stable

info on experimental gui is displayed with vertical scroll bar (bug #41840) main-window.cc (show_gui_info): show info text within a QTextEdit
author Torsten <ttl@justmail.de>
date Wed, 19 Mar 2014 23:23:50 +0100
parents 2f39b386d399
children 53ba52143af7
files libgui/src/main-window.cc
diffstat 1 files changed, 9 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/libgui/src/main-window.cc	Tue Mar 18 10:20:50 2014 -0700
+++ b/libgui/src/main-window.cc	Wed Mar 19 23:23:50 2014 +0100
@@ -1923,8 +1923,15 @@
 
   QMessageBox gui_info_dialog (QMessageBox::Warning,
                                tr ("Experimental GUI Info"),
-                               gui_info, QMessageBox::Close);
-
+                               QString (gui_info.length (),' '), QMessageBox::Close);
+  QGridLayout *box_layout
+      = qobject_cast<QGridLayout *>(gui_info_dialog.layout());
+  if (box_layout)
+    {
+      QTextEdit *text = new QTextEdit(gui_info);
+      text->setReadOnly(true);
+      box_layout->addWidget(text, 0, 1);
+    }
   gui_info_dialog.exec ();
 }